Output 66d79a19f1ee7a1dc73b338e792054e3539ec4966a7093c958e7c3fa9877345c:8

value
188216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ce7ecf1c5241d1af00899d7235e6148573876a1a OP_EQUAL
address
3LWs2uXPzn36W4B6NDWVGTb53XJRMtFjhj
transaction
66d79a19f1ee7a1dc73b338e792054e3539ec4966a7093c958e7c3fa9877345c
spent
true